Alexander Howard BLENCOWE

Regimental number1678
Place of birthOne Tree Hill, South Australia
SchoolPublic School, South Australia
ReligionMethodist
OccupationFarmer
AddressOnetree Hill, South Australia
Marital statusSingle
Age at embarkation28
Next of kinMother, Mrs Isabelle Blencowe, Onetree Hill, South Australia
Enlistment date2 September 1915
Date of enlistment from Nominal Roll28 August 1915
Rank on enlistmentPrivate
Unit name32nd Battalion, 2nd Reinforcement
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/49/2
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Adelaide, South Australia, on board HMAT A30 Borda on 11 January 1916
Rank from Nominal RollPrivate
Unit from Nominal Roll48th Battalion
FateDied of wounds 1 September 1916
Place of death or woundingPozieres, France
Date of death1 September 1916
Age at death29
Age at death from cemetery records29
Place of burialPuchevillers British Cemetery (Plot III, Row F, Grave No. 38), France
